Subject: [PATCH 26/50] xfs: use xfs_alloc_vextent_this_ag() where appropriate
Date: Sat, 11 Jun 2022 11:26:35 +1000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20220611012659.3418072-27-david@fromorbit.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20220611012659.3418072-1-david@fromorbit.com>

From: Dave Chinner <dchinner@redhat.com>

Change obvious callers of single AG allocation to use
xfs_alloc_vextent_this_ag(). Drive the per-ag grabbing out to the
callers, too, so that callers with active references don't need
to do new lookups just for an allocation in a context that already
has a perag reference.

The only remaining caller that does single AG allocation through
xfs_alloc_vextent() is xfs_bmap_btalloc() with
XFS_ALLOCTYPE_NEAR_BNO. That is going to need more untangling before
it can be converted cleanly.
